Output d335a505de8dab3d83c027b8db66ba1a6d245a4d8faeb7c5bf4cd0e043677d03:1

value
9396610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74482255c54d62c6933c21dd3ad71af377e2f9f0 OP_EQUAL
address
3CHrimBxEg3wyiJYE4Yjf4s1bKoPdgRr3u
transaction
d335a505de8dab3d83c027b8db66ba1a6d245a4d8faeb7c5bf4cd0e043677d03
spent
true